Avnet, Inc. Reports First Quarter Fiscal Year 2015 Results
Top-Line Growth and Operating Leverage Drives Improved Profitability

Phoenix, October 23, 2014 - Avnet, Inc. (NYSE:AVT) today announced results for the first quarter fiscal year 2015 ended September 27, 2014.

Sales for the quarter ended September 27, 2014 increased 7.8% year over year to $6.8 billion; organic sales (as defined later in the document) grew 5.8% year over year and 5.6% in constant currency
Adjusted operating income of $223.7 million increased 12.2% year over year and adjusted operating income margin of 3.3% increased 13 basis points year over year
Adjusted net income of $144.2 million increased 14.4% and adjusted diluted earnings per share of $1.02 increased 13.3% year over year

Rick Hamada, Chief Executive Officer, commented, “Our team carried the momentum of fiscal 2014 into our new fiscal year as they leveraged continued revenue growth into another year-over-year increase in EPS. At an enterprise level, year-over-year organic revenue grew 5.6% in constant dollars led by a sixth consecutive quarter of year-over-year organic growth at Electronics Marketing (EM), along with a return to positive growth at Technology Solutions (TS). This top-line growth, combined with an increase in gross profit margin at EM and continued expense efficiencies across the enterprise, resulted in operating income growing 1.6 times faster than revenue and operating income margin increasing 13 basis points year over year to 3.3%. Even given an environment of heightened sensitivity to current market conditions, we remain focused on profitable growth opportunities and will continue to align our investments toward maintaining our





momentum. With our strong team and financial position, we have the resources to respond as needed while continuing to return cash to shareholders via both our dividend and disciplined share repurchase program."

Reported sales increased 11.1% year over year to $4.4 billion while organic sales were up 7.8% in constant currency
Operating income margin increased 17 basis points year over year to 4.6% due to improvements across all three regions
Working capital (defined as receivables plus inventory less accounts payables) increased 2.4% sequentially and was up 8.4% year over year primarily due to the increase in sales and the acquisition of MSC;
Return on working capital (ROWC) increased 86 basis points year over year and decreased 150 basis points sequentially

Mr. Hamada added, “EM delivered another quarter of top-line growth that was at the high end of expectations and normal seasonality while expanding margins and returns year over year. In the September quarter, revenue increased 2.3% sequentially in constant currency, primarily due to a 10.8% increase in Asia partially offset by seasonal declines in the western regions. On a year-over-year basis, EM’s organic revenue grew 7.8% led by the Asia region, which increased over 13.2%. Operating income grew 15.3% year over year with all three regions delivering double digit growth and operating income margin increased 17 basis points to 4.6%. Although September is typically a seasonally weak quarter for EM, our team delivered another quarter of improved financial performance across all regions. In Asia, where select high volume supply chain engagements are driving much of the current top-line growth, the team continues to increase returns and grow economic profit dollars. In EMEA, our team delivered a sixth consecutive quarter of year-over-year organic growth, and with the integration of MSC now essentially complete, our team is back to posting year-over-year increases in both margins and returns. In our Americas region, the team returned to modest year-over-year revenue growth, which drove an increase in both margins and returns. While our book to bill ratio was slightly above parity at the end of the quarter, we are diligently monitoring our dashboards and we remain committed to driving further improvement in our financial performance as we continue to focus on our goals for the full fiscal year.”

Reported sales increased 2.4% year over year to $2.5 billion and organic sales increased 2.0% in constant currency primarily due to strength in the Americas region
Operating income margin decreased 7 basis points year over year primarily due to a decline in the Americas and Asia regions partially offset by an improvement in the EMEA region
ROWC decreased 282 basis points year over year primarily due to lower operating income in the Asia region
At a product level, year-over-year growth in software, services, and networking and security, was partially offset by a decline in computing components

Mr. Hamada further added, "During our September quarter, TS delivered top-line growth of 2.4% year over year driven by strength in our Americas region, which experienced double digit organic growth for the first time in three years. In our EMEA region, which declined 5.8% in constant currency, mid-single digit growth in our core enterprise distribution business was offset by a decline in our computing components business. TS Asia was below our expectations this quarter as revenue declined 14.6% sequentially with this weakness reflected broadly across the region. In our TS EMEA region, our team has been driving efficiencies as operating income margin improved both sequentially and year over year. Going forward, we will continue to utilize our disciplined portfolio management to ensure we are focusing our resources on high growth opportunities in the enterprise IT ecosystem.”

Cash Flow/Dividend

Cash used for operations was $40.7 million in the September quarter and for the trailing twelve months, cash generated from operations was $323.0 million
Cash and cash equivalents at the end of the quarter was $814.4 million; net debt (total debt less cash and cash equivalents) was approximately $1.3 billion
The Company repurchased 423,419 shares during the quarter at an aggregate cost of $17.8 million. Entering the second quarter, the Company had approximately $198 million remaining under the current authorization
The Company paid a quarterly dividend of $0.16 per share or $22.1 million

Kevin Moriarty, Chief Financial Officer, stated, “We used roughly $41 million in cash flow to fund operations for the quarter as the working capital grew to support our organic sales growth. Despite the use of cash during the quarter, the trailing twelve months cash flow generated from operations improved by 36% to $323 million, and we exited the quarter with roughly $814 million of cash on our balance sheet. Our disciplined





approach to our capital allocation priorities has positioned us well for the recent equity market environment and, during the quarter, we returned approximately $40 million to shareholders. In the September quarter, we raised our quarterly dividend by 7% to an annualized $0.64 a year, or $22 million per quarter, while also repurchasing approximately $18 million of shares through our share repurchase program. We began our fiscal second quarter with approximately $198 million remaining under our currently authorized share repurchase program, and through the first three weeks of our second fiscal quarter have repurchased approximately $55 million of shares. As of the end of September, we have over $2.0 billion of liquidity to support continued organic growth initiatives, invest in value creating M&A and shareholder returns.”

Outlook for Second Quarter of Fiscal 2015 Ending on December 27, 2014

EM sales are expected to be in the range of $4.15 billion to $4.45 billion and TS sales are expected to be in the range of $2.85 billion to $3.15 billion
Avnet sales are forecasted to be in the range of $7.0 billion and $7.6 billion
Adjusted diluted earnings per share is forecasted to be in the range of $1.15 to $1.25 per share
The guidance assumes 139.0 million average diluted shares outstanding and a tax rate of 27% to 31%

The above guidance excludes the amortization of intangibles and any potential restructuring, integration and other expenses. In addition, the above guidance assumes that the average U.S. Dollar to Euro currency exchange rate for the second quarter of fiscal 2015 is $1.27 to 1.00. This compares with an average exchange rate of $1.36 to 1.00 in the second quarter of fiscal 2014 and $1.33 to 1.00 in the first quarter of fiscal 2015.

Non-GAAP Financial Information
In addition to disclosing financial results that are determined in accordance with generally accepted accounting principles in the United States (“GAAP”), the Company also discloses in this document certain non-GAAP financial information including adjusted operating income, adjusted net income and adjusted diluted earnings per share, as well as sales adjusted for the impact of acquisitions and other items (as





defined in the Organic Sales section of this document). Management believes organic sales is a useful measure for evaluating current period performance as compared with prior periods and for understanding underlying trends.
Management believes that operating income adjusted for (i) restructuring, integration and other expenses and (ii) amortization of acquired intangible assets and other, is a useful measure to help investors better assess and understand the Company’s operating performance, especially when comparing results with previous periods or forecasting performance for future periods, primarily because management views the excluded items to be outside of Avnet’s normal operating results or non-cash in nature. Management analyzes operating income without the impact of these items as an indicator of ongoing margin performance and underlying trends in the business. Management also uses these non-GAAP measures to establish operational goals and, in some cases, for measuring performance for compensation purposes.
Management believes net income and diluted EPS adjusted for (i) the impact of the items described above, (ii) certain items impacting income tax expense and (iii) the gain on legal settlement, is useful to investors because it provides a measure of the Company’s net profitability on a more comparable basis to historical periods and provides a more meaningful basis for forecasting future performance. Additionally, because of management’s focus on generating shareholder value, of which net profitability is a primary driver, management believes net income and diluted EPS excluding the impact of these items provides an important measure of the Company’s net results for the investing public.
Other metrics management monitors in its assessment of business performance include return on working capital (ROWC), return on capital employed (ROCE) and working capital velocity (WC velocity).

ROWC is defined as annualized adjusted operating income (as defined above) divided by the sum of the monthly average balances of receivables and inventories less accounts payable.

ROCE is defined as annualized, tax effected adjusted operating income (as defined above) divided by the monthly average balances of interest-bearing debt and equity (including the impact of adjustments to operating income discussed above) less cash and cash equivalents.

WC velocity is defined as annualized sales divided by the sum of the monthly average balances of receivables and inventories less accounts payable.
Any analysis of results and outlook on a non-GAAP basis should be used as a complement to, and in conjunction with, results presented in accordance with GAAP.

Organic Sales
Organic sales is defined as reported sales adjusted for the impact of acquisitions and divestitures by adjusting Avnet’s prior periods to include the sales of acquired businesses and exclude the sales of divested businesses as if the acquisitions and divestitures had occurred at the beginning of the earliest period presented.

The following table presents the reconciliation of reported sales to organic sales for the first quarter of fiscal 2014. For quarterly periods after the first quarter of fiscal 2014, reported sales are equivalent to organic sales.

About Avnet
Avnet, Inc. (NYSE:AVT), a Fortune 500 company, is one of the largest distributors of electronic components, computer products and embedded technology serving customers globally. Avnet accelerates its partners' success by connecting the world's leading technology suppliers with a broad base of customers by providing cost-effective, value-added services and solutions. For the fiscal year ended June 28, 2014, Avnet generated sales of $27.5 billion. For more information, visit www.avnet.com. (AVT_IR)
